Jubilee Ministries is seeking full-time and part-time Prison Chaplains for the various prisons where they provide services in Eastern Pennsylvania (Luzerne and Schuylkill Counties). The primary role of the chaplain is to provide pastoral care for inmates. Chaplain duties include the following: leading or supervising worship services, visiting inmate housing areas for conversations and prayer, teaching Bible studies, counseling inmates one-on-one, leading group discussions, coaching in life skills, and record-keeping of all activities. Chaplains must possess the wisdom to set appropriate boundaries with inmates to minimize deception and enabling of criminal behaviors. It is essential to be flexible to this ever-changing environment and to be respectful of prison policies and staff.
